> > Since the tree is still full of too broad dependencies and other
> > mistakes, I would like to add a repoman check and a matching QA
> > policy regarding how slots should be used in dependencies.
> 
> > The check would apply to EAPI 5 and newer ebuilds only. Considering
> > the past uproar against having slotted dependencies against
> > single-slot packages, it would apply only to dependencies that match
> > more than one slot of a package.
> 
> For what type of dependencies would that check apply? IIUC, it would
> only make sense for packages that appear both in DEPEND and RDEPEND.

The test is applied to RDEPEND only. I don't think it's a good idea to
play with intersections of dependencies -- that would be hard to
implement and therefore fragile.

Furthermore, :* guarantees runtime switching support. Lack of any
operator indicates semi-undefined behavior, e.g. paludis tries
the safest route possible and requires all slots installed at build
time.
